Ghosts and Spirits Walking Tour

On this tour, you’ll hear the eerie tales and dark secrets of a 300-year-old European neighbourhood. Learn the real history of colourful characters who lived, died, and have chosen to remain in the French Quarter. Follow their shadows down cobbled alleys, through streets aglow with gas lamps and feel the mythical presence that makes New Orleans the most haunted city in America.

Highlights

  • Hear eerie stories and dark secrets of the most haunted city in America
  • Visit haunted sites documented by paranormal investigators
  • Learn about real chronicles of life and death by fires, epidemics, hurricanes, floods, wars, slavery, and conflict
  • Use augmented reality software to pose for a picture with Voodoo Queen Marie Laveau or crackle in the Great Fire of 1788
